Om Shanti Om is a 2007 Indian Hindi-language Drama, masala film written and directed by Farah Khan, co-written by Mayur Puri and Mushtaq Shiekh, and produced by Gauri Khan (wife of Shah Rukh Khan) under Red Chillies Entertainment.

In the last song of this film and ending dance song, we saw many Bollywood actors and actresses perform one by one with Shah Rukh Khan also including Salman Khan and Dharmendra dance performances.

Farah Khan recently recalled that Superstar Salman Khan waited patiently on the sets of Om Shanti Om for four hours just so he could see Dharmendra dance performance.

The song ‘Deewangi Deewangi’ featured 30 film stars in a cameo and Farah had meticulously planned the shoot of the song across many days just so she could make a song reminiscent of Naseeb’s ‘John Jani Janardhan’. Talking on the YouTube channel of IFTDA Official, Farah Khan recently recalled, “There is a shot where Dharam ji is dancing perform, and Salman Khan and others jump in. That wasn’t planned. They were standing behind the camera because they waited for four hours in Shah Rukh Khan’s van to watch Dharam ji’s shot. And while Dharam ji was come for dancing, they just jumped into the shot without plan.”

The portion of the song featuring Dharmendra Sir had Shah Rukh Khan accompanying him. But eventually, Salman Khan and Saif Ali Khan jump in. Farah said that Saif wasn’t prepared for this and the surprise of the moment was evident on his face. “If you see Saif Ali Khan, he doesn’t know what is happening. He’s like ‘kya ho raha hai? (what is happening?)” And they all just enjoying the happy moment because of Salman Khan.

Om Shanti Om released in 2007 starring Shah Rukh Khan and co-actress Deepika Padukon, actually this is the first Bollywood film of Deepika.
